Сколько времени занимает сборка мусора на SSD: факторы и советы

Введение в работу SSD и процесс TRIM

Технология твердотельных накопителей (SSD) изменила подход к хранению данных, обеспечивая высокую скорость чтения и записи. Однако, чтобы понять, как работает SSD, необходимо рассмотреть такие понятия, как команда TRIM и процесс сборки мусора. В этой статье мы обсудим работу TRIM, процесс удаления данных и его влияние на возможность восстановления файлов.

Что такое команда TRIM?

Команда TRIM — это специальная команда, которая сообщает SSD, какие страницы данных больше не используются. После удаления файла операционная система Windows отправляет команду TRIM на SSD, которая отмечает страницы, содержащие данные, как недействительные. Это позволяет контроллеру SSD более эффективно управлять памятью и уменьшает время, необходимое для записи новых данных.

Процесс сборки мусора и его время выполнения

После того как данные были помечены как недействительные с помощью TRIM, на очереди стоит процесс сборки мусора. Это процесс, при котором контроллер SSD собирает действително данные, чтобы освободить место, занятое недействительными страницами. Вопрос, который интересует многих пользователей, заключается в том, как долго происходит этот процесс.

На современных SSD, таких как PCIe NVMe, время сбора мусора может варьироваться в зависимости от модели и нагрузки на диск. Обычно, сборка мусора выполняется практически в реальном времени и может занимать от нескольких миллисекунд до нескольких секунд. Однако, если у вас много недействительных страниц, процесс может занять больше времени.

Восстановление данных: сколько времени у вас есть?

Еще одной важной темой является возможность восстановления данных после их удаления. Многие пользователи задаются вопросом, сколько времени после удаления файла данные остаются доступными для восстановления. Это зависит от нескольких факторов, включая частоту записи на SSD и время, прошедшее с момента удаления данных.

Если говорить о сроках, то в большинстве случаев данные могут оставаться в "плуготехническом" состоянии в течение 24 часов, а затем их восстановление становится все более сложным. Через неделю или месяц вероятность восстановления данных резко снижается, поскольку сборка мусора может стереть недействительные страницы, что делает восстановление практически невозможным.

Безопасность данных и обход FTL

FTL (Flash Translation Layer) — это слой, который управляет физическим размещением данных на SSD. Если кто-то попытается обойти FTL, имея доступ к необработанным блокам данных, следует учитывать, что со временем эти блоки будут очищены в процессе сборки мусора.

Как долго это займет? Время зависит от активности записи на SSD и общих операций, проводимых на диске. Это может варьироваться от нескольких дней до месяцев, в зависимости от того, как активно использовался диск.

Заключение

Современные технологии SSD, такие как PCIe NVMe, предоставляют пользователям высокую скорость и надежность. Однако понимание процессов TRIM, сборки мусора и возможностей восстановления данных критически важно для правильного использования таких накопителей. Важно помнить, что после удаления данных время на восстановление стремительно уменьшается, а процессы очистки данных происходят в фоне, усложняя ситуацию с восстановлением. Поэтому, если у вас есть важные данные, лучше заранее позаботиться о надежном резервном копировании.

Источник

Ответить

Ваш адрес email не будет опубликован. Обязательные поля помечены *